Ticket SKY-1187 — Session token refresh fails after clock skew. Summary for release review: the Duskmere client refreshes its session token 60 seconds before expiry, but the check compares local time to server-issued expiry without skew tolerance. On devices running more than a minute fast, refresh never fires and users get silently logged out mid-task. Fix adds a 5-minute skew window plus a forced refresh on 401. Regression suite passes on all three platforms. The candidate build's trace token appears below.

trace token, taguf-yajop: htk6_3fef6e

Subject: Inkwell markdown pipeline 5.1 deployed

On-call: the Inkwell rendering pipeline is now on 5.1 in production. Changes: sanitizer runs before the table parser, footnote rendering is cached per document, and the fallback plain-text path no longer strips headings. If render latency alarms fire, roll back via the standard script — it handles cache invalidation. Known issue: nested blockquotes over six levels render flat. The deployment trace token follows.

build token for hawep-kageg: htk14_558814e2114cc7

Subject: DR Drill — Lintbase Baseline Restoration

Team,

During next week's disaster-recovery drill we will rebuild the Quillfort pipeline from scratch, including the static-analysis baseline file that suppresses legacy findings. Do not regenerate the baseline; restore the archived copy so historical suppressions stay intact. The archive vault requires two approvals plus the recovery passphrase, which for drill continuity is recorded immediately below.

unlock words, kagef-taduf: fenir-quenix-norwyn-sorvan-gormir-gorir-fraok

# Handover: Greenloft Wiki RBAC

Passing the role-based access layer of the Greenloft wiki to you. For plugin authors: permissions resolve at page-render time, roles are additive, and plugins must never cache a resolved role longer than one request. There are four built-in roles; custom roles are declared in config, not code. Deny rules always win over grants. The current role and permission configuration is shown below.

deployment values, tafog-kagap:
wenath:
  pin: 4244
  metrics_host: metrics.wenath.lumicsys.internal
  tenant: istix
  seal: seal_10585894